Juicy Gen!tals is a one-day immersive space to reconnect with your body and your gen!tals. Not as something to fix or perform with, but as something to listen to, befriend, and explore at your own pace.
Throughout the day, we move between inner exploration and embodied experience.
There will be space for reflection, sensing, sharing, and also an invitation to explore self-touch in a new, more present way. Always optional.
This is not about getting somewhere.
It’s about slowing down enough to notice what is already here.

✦ Hands-on (optional) ✦
At a certain point in the day, there will be space for those who wish to explore self-touch in a more conscious and connected way.
This is not a technical or performance-based approach, but an invitation to:
- slow down
- listen to your body
- and meet yourself with more presence and care
You are always free to:
- remain fully clothed
- or step in and out as it feels right
By joining, you consent to the possibility that others might choose to be undressed.
